Hi guys,

Some are already aware of my problem, but I'm having a serious issue with graphics settings vs replay. As some may know, my PC is old and can't run smoothly with hi-quality graphics, so I play with minimum quality. I drove a few laps around Hockenheim 2006 with the 2004 Ferrari and I set a lap 0.019s slower than Schumacher's pole lap from 2004. I'm happy yay ! So I save the replay (as unlimited practice, not hotlap, as usual) and I exit the game to change graphics to maximum quality before recording the lap. So I turn on the game again and load the .upl file. I then rewind to the beginning of the 3 minute replay and fast forward until the end of the lap before the one I want to record. I actually spun in the middle of the double right-hander at the exit of the Stadium, so I went back on track facing the wrong way to spin myself in order to get an optimum speed exiting the last corner.

Now is the tricky part : when I drove the laps, all went well and I could finish my laps perfectly. But this time, on max graphics replay, the car veers offline on the inside of the penultimate corner and it keeps receiving steering, throttle and braking inputs as if it was still on track. You can make out Turn 1, Turn 2 and Turn 3 from the HUD. And then, WOOF!, the replay goes back to normal after Turn 3 on the back straight. Just for fun, I revert to low quality graphics and everything is normal again ! As a matter of fact, I didn't change the car wad, track wad, physics and performance. Neither do I use car restore state.

The way replays are stored in GPx is by storing memory snapshots. It doesn't store them each frame though. In between snapshots it only records the input. This works because the random number generator state is restored from the memory snapshot. The fact that it breaks with different graphics settings indicates a bug in GP4, in which it calls the RNG more or less times than witih other graphics settings.

Since the replay says it was recorded with 1.00 I suspect that you're using GP4 1.00, not 1.02. What does gpxpload.txt say about it?
